Specialty
ENT Specialist
An otolaryngologist-head and neck surgeon provides comprehensive medical and surgical care for patients with diseases and disorders that affect the ears, nose, throat, the respiratory and upper alimentary systems and related structures of the head and neck.

About
Dr. Richard Elliott Sterling is an ENT specialist in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. He earned his MD from the Lewis Katz School of Medicine at Temple University and completed residency training at the Medical University of South Carolina. His listed focus areas include sinusitis, nasal polyps, hearing loss, earwax blockage, tinnitus, allergies, and other nose and ear conditions. He speaks English.
